II. Types of Modern Bathrooms:

There are several types of modern bathrooms, each with its unique style and features. Some popular types include:

1. Scandinavian-Inspired Bathrooms: These bathrooms embrace the concept of hygge, a Danish term that emphasizes coziness and comfort. They often feature natural materials like wood and stone, combined with soft colors and minimalist furnishings.

2. Industrial-Chic Bathrooms: Inspired by urban lofts and warehouses, industrial-chic bathrooms incorporate raw materials like exposed brick, concrete, and metal. They often have an edgy and utilitarian aesthetic, with open shelving, vintage fixtures, and salvaged elements.

3. Zen Bathrooms: Inspired by Asian design principles, Zen bathrooms create a sense of tranquility and balance. They feature clean lines, natural materials, and a minimalistic approach to decor. Water features, such as rain showers and freestanding tubs, are commonly incorporated to enhance the calming ambiance.

4. High-Tech Bathrooms: These bathrooms embrace the latest technological innovations to provide a truly modern experience. Smart toilets with bidet functions, motion-activated faucets, and integrated sound systems are just a few examples of the high-tech features that can be found in these bathrooms.

III. Quantitative Measurements of Modern Bathrooms:

To understand the impact of modern bathrooms, it is essential to consider some quantitative measurements:

1. Energy Efficiency: Modern bathrooms often prioritize energy-efficient fixtures and appliances. For example, low-flow toilets and showerheads can significantly reduce water consumption, while LED lighting fixtures can save energy and last longer.

2. Space Optimization: Modern bathrooms are designed to maximize space utilization. Creative storage solutions, such as recessed cabinets and wall-mounted vanities, help keep the space clutter-free.

3. Return on Investment: Upgrading your bathroom to a modern design can provide a high return on investment. According to real estate experts, modern bathrooms are highly desirable among potential buyers and can significantly increase the value of your home.

IV. Differentiating Factors Among Modern Bathrooms:

While modern bathrooms share common features, there are several factors that differentiate them from one another:

1. Color Palette: The choice of colors in a modern bathroom can significantly impact its overall aesthetic. From monochromatic and neutral tones to bold and vibrant hues, the color palette sets the tone for the space.

2. Materials and Finishes: The selection of materials and finishes can transform a bathroom from ordinary to extraordinary. Whether it’s using natural stone tiles or opting for sleek glass and chrome finishes, the choice of materials plays a crucial role in defining the modern aesthetic.

3. Lighting: Modern bathrooms often incorporate a combination of natural and artificial lighting. Strategically placed windows and skylights allow ample natural light to flood the space, while recessed lighting and pendant lights provide additional illumination and create a warm ambiance.

4. Fixtures and Fittings: The choice of fixtures and fittings can greatly impact the functionality and style of a modern bathroom. From minimalist faucets and showerheads to freestanding bathtubs and wall-hung toilets, selecting the right fixtures is essential to achieve a cohesive and modern look.

V. Historical Overview of Pros and Cons of Modern Bathrooms:

Modern bathrooms have come a long way throughout history, with several advantages and disadvantages associated with different design eras.

1. Mid-century Modern Bathrooms: In the 1950s and 1960s, mid-century modern bathrooms gained popularity. They were characterized by bold colors, geometric patterns, and futuristic fixtures. While these bathrooms were visually striking, they often lacked sufficient storage and energy-efficient features.

2. 1980s/1990s Contemporary Bathrooms: During this era, contemporary bathrooms embraced a minimalist approach, with neutral color schemes, clean lines, and functional fixtures. However, limited technological advancements and design innovations restricted their potential.

3. Present-day Modern Bathrooms: Today’s modern bathrooms combine the best of past design eras with the latest innovations. They offer a perfect balance between style, functionality, and sustainability, making them highly desirable among homeowners.
